Overview

Last season, the Ohio Bobcats delivered a dominant performance in the 2024 MAC Championship Game, rolling past rival Miami (OH) 38-3 to secure the conference crown. It was a statement win for a Bobcats team that had steadily built momentum throughout the season and left no doubt in the title matchup.

Ohio and Miami both finished 7-1 in conference play, with the Bobcats posting an 11-3 overall record and the RedHawks finishing 9-5. Buffalo (6-2 MAC, 9-4 overall) and Bowling Green (6-2 MAC, 7-6 overall) also remained in contention deep into the season, while Western Michigan (5-3 MAC, 6-6 overall) rounded out the group of winning conference records.

MAC Championship

The Mid-American Conference (MAC) Championship is awarded each year to the winner of the MAC Championship Game. The conference no longer uses divisions; instead, the two teams with the best conference records – based on winning percentage and applicable tiebreakers – advance to the title game. The winner of this single-game matchup is crowned MAC champion.

Preseason Team Spotlights

Toledo Rockets (+260)

Toledo remains the standard in the MAC, having consistently been in the title conversation under head coach Jason Candle. The Rockets are known for their physical defense and efficient offensive execution, particularly in the run game. With experience on both sides of the ball and a proven coaching staff, Toledo is built for another deep run.

At +260, the Rockets are a strong favorite and offer reliable value for bettors seeking a team with both pedigree and recent success in MAC play.

Ohio Bobcats (+425)

Ohio enters 2025 looking to defend its MAC crown after a dominant 38–3 win over Miami (OH) in last year’s championship game. While a new era begins under first-year head coach Brian Smith, the Bobcats return a strong core from the team that went 7–1 in conference play and 11–3 overall. Known for their physical defense and balanced offensive approach, Ohio has the tools to stay at the top of the conference.

At +425, the Bobcats offer solid value as reigning champions with a steady foundation and a chance to repeat under new leadership.

Miami (OH) RedHawks (+650)

Miami (OH) has quietly been one of the steadiest programs in the MAC, and 2024 was no different with a 7–1 conference record. The RedHawks play sound, fundamental football and often win the turnover battle. Head coach Chuck Martin’s veteran leadership and a tough-minded roster give them a high floor heading into 2025.

At +650, Miami is an intriguing value play for bettors looking for a bounce-back season from a perennial contender.

Buffalo Bulls (+750)

The Bulls showed real progress in 2024, finishing 9–4 overall and 6–2 in MAC play under head coach Pete Lembo, who now enters his second season at the helm. Known for his special teams expertise and disciplined approach, Lembo has helped bring stability to a Buffalo program with a solid core on both sides of the ball. Their physicality up front and ability to win close games make them a tough out in the conference.

At +750, Buffalo offers sneaky value for bettors who believe Lembo can continue elevating the program in year two.

Bowling Green Falcons (+1000)

Bowling Green enters 2025 with a new identity under first-year head coach Eddie George, who brings a fresh perspective and a player-first mentality to the program. The Falcons finished 6–2 in conference play and 7–6 overall last season, showing flashes of defensive grit and competitive resilience. While the offense still needs refinement, the roster returns enough experience to stay in the mix.

At +1000, Bowling Green is a compelling longshot – and if George’s leadership clicks early, they could emerge as one of the MAC’s surprise contenders.
